Around 7,000 years ago, in what is now Romania, two small clay figures were crafted, that look surprisingly modern. One is known as The Thinker, a seated man with his head in hands, seemingly lost in contemplation, or perhaps resigned to sadness. Beside him is the Sitting Woman, seeming composed and perhaps observant. They come from the Hamangia culture, a Neolithic society that lived along the western Black Sea coast between about 5250 BC and 4,500 BC.
